MFC got “owned” during our weekly Sunday soccer friendly against an unfamiliar team that consists of China players. As what Capt GX had said in the post match comments, he felt that MFC had taken the game too lightly and had underestimated our opponents.
The game kicked off with MFC taking the lead through a brilliant free kick, courtesy of Rong An Di Santos. He took it confidently, beating the wall of defense to curl the ball in to make it 1-0 to MFC. MFCians continue to pressure the opponents with Jeff, Paul, RongAn and others saw their chances went begging. Seeing how frail MFC was in the attacking options, the opponents then took the offensive approach and kept on launching in balls through the centre. Their passing possession in midfield was far more superior to MFC and we seemed to have problems silencing their player maker “Messy” during the game. He alone managed to take on a couple of us and it took him not too long to respond to their one goal deficit. Messy dribbled and did a through pass for their striker to make it 1-1 before halftime.
The second half saw a couple of chances in the lineup, with Randall and Gary swapping positions. Gary played RB for the first time and was excited about not using his hands to pick kick ball. He and Alywin were tormented down the right flank by the in-flood of the Chinese players. Soon after, MFC experienced the loss of ball possession in most parts of the field and the Chinese team took the game to a 4-1 lead for them. Each goal they scored seemed to be a World Cup Final goal. Their celebrations and hand gestures seems to suggest so. haha.
MFC had a shout out for 2 penalties in the late 2nd half of the game, but was clearly rejected by our beloved China Referee-GuanYu. He understood that the opponent’s hand ball foul was unintentional and their GK foul on Capt GX in the penalty box a clean dance move from the GK.
Jeffery Gerrard did well enough 5mins from time to pull one goal back for us as he followed up the GK’s punch out effort and placed the ball in neatly into the bottom left hand corner of the net. That goal did boost up MFC’s morale as we searched for another goal. Our 3rd goal never came and things got worse for us when they slotted in their fifth goal of the game through a neat one two play. The day ended leaving most MFCians dejected but we will definitely be looking to pick ourselves up for the next game.
